Output 689b67e01636458ca73dfdf8b88715c11d3a8c4ae7a2570efdde34291a881931:2

value
5624390877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05d081a2d0525673e6053c48f2fe00f2b2786037 OP_EQUALVERIFY OP_CHECKSIG
address
D5fqhVhQzX7nrKixAHLqRVVU6vS7a4Kj1r
transaction
689b67e01636458ca73dfdf8b88715c11d3a8c4ae7a2570efdde34291a881931